If an A (Adenine) were swapped for a T (Thymine) it will lead to A TRANSVERSION TYPE OF POINT MUTATION.
Replacement of an A with a T is a transversion type of point mutation because in transversion the purine is replaced with a pyrimidine. Since in this case only one nucleotide is replaced, it is a point mutation.

Sensory receptor
Sensory receptor is known to
be a structure that responds to a physical stimulus in the environment which
can either be external or internal. Also, sensory receptor generally initiates the
same process of creating nerve signals and registering stimuli. Generally, sensory receptor usually serves as the front liner because they are in contact
with the stimulus.

In an olfactory system, odor molecules are perceived by the olfactory receptors. These odor molecules are nothing but the chemicals which are then transduced as chemical signals into the electrical signals and sent to the brain. The brain perceives these electrical signals as smell.
The odorant particles bind to the specific receptors located at cilia which then signal through the G protein Gαolf which then activate adenylate cyclase. Adenylate cyclase leads to cAMP production which then open a cyclic nucleotide-gated ion channel through which both sodium and calcium ion entern into the cell. Calcium ion then activates chloride channels and thereby causing transduction of electrical signal
